Replication is failing with an error message about inserting a duplicate record into a reprint table, what can I do when a duplicate record error is present?

|||enable logging as described in this kb article.
http://support.microsoft.com/default...&Product=sql2k
find the offending row and evaluate whether you can delete it at the
subscriber.
You may want to right click on your distribution agent and stop it and then
select the continue on data constency errors. When you clear the errors you
should run a validation to ensure your databases are in sync.
